Do elephants eat peanuts - Elephants eat peanuts – and they always have – because they were fed them. It is believed today, however – that elephants don’t really like the taste of peanuts – they actually just liked the idea of eating them as something to do. A way of getting human attention in an often lonely and boring zoo enclosure.

In fact, they may even like it more. Peanut butter is not only a delicious treat for ...Myth #1: Elephants love to eat peanuts Origin of the myth. One of the most common misconceptions about elephants is that they love to eat peanuts. This myth likely originated from circuses and zoos, where elephants were often given peanuts as a form of reward.
